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Dance musician Kiings?

The American Electronic Dance music performer Kiings has worked with other skilled musicians to produce enthralling compositions. The song "Feel" with Rae Cassidy is one of their memorable collaborations. The combination of Cassidy's captivating voice and Kiings' electronic soundscapes creates a hauntingly beautiful song that has an impact on listeners.

The "You Can't See Me" collaboration with Christine Hoberg is another outstanding effort. Hoberg's ethereal voice gives Kiings' elaborate production a delicate finishing touch, resulting in a captivating fusion of electronic and pop elements. The song demonstrates their capacity to produce an enthralling environment that is both reflective and emotionally powerful.

Additionally, Kiings collaborated on "1984" alongside King Courteen, WebsterX, Bliss & Alice. The flexibility of Kiings is on display in this duet as they expertly meld several musical genres. The song's explosive blend of rap sections, electronic sounds, and soulful vocals makes for an original and engrossing listening experience.
